Super Mario 3D land review:Super Mario 3D land is a complicated game because on one hand the levels are fun and easy to play through. on another some levels are just dreadful. the end of the game drags on. the controls also aren't perfect.Graphics: 8/10This game did great with graphics and is one of the best 3ds games. they also attempted to make 3d necessary but it definitely isn't. the graphics are more plastic or shiny than other mario games but it looks good. however the camera movement wasn't great.Level design: 6.5/10This game has great levels and bad levels. sometimes the level design is enjoyable and has interesting twists or enemies but other times it's just frustrating and confusing. i also didn't like how you had to search for star medals to unlock certain parts of the game. sometimes you explore for secrets and you still don't find a star medal it might be a one up which is still a great surprise but obviously i'd rather get what i came for. also there isn't much of a point in having any power up other than the tanuki leaf which makes it frustrating when you don't have it. it definitely makes levels more fun though.Bosses: 3/10Probably the weakest part of this game you just fight the same boss over and over again. there are a few bowser fights and other than that it alternates from boom boom to palm palm. while the fights change from time to time they are still the basic concept of jump on their head where other 3d mario games like galaxy and odyssey use creative ways to damage bosses. the bosses just feel basic and not unique. except for the final boss that one is pretty cool.World map: **** this games world map. each world (8) has a theme yet none of the themes match the setting of the level. there could be a water level in a lava world or sky level in a desert world it just doesn't make sense. what's the point of having a world map if it's gonna be this ass.Power ups: 8/10Pretty decent power ups in this game but the tanuki suit is the best so it makes other powerups feel useless. you shouldn't have a power up that is so much better than the rest that it makes the others less enjoyable.Controls: 7/10The controls have their ups and downs. the 4 main buttons are fine but the issue lies within the circle pad, while it's better than controlling a 3d game with a dpad (super mario 64 ds) is still isn't perfect and is much worse than your typical analog stick. the long jump in this game is also ridiculously underpowered than other 3d games. honestly making the long jump almost useless since it just isn't efficient. that might be a side effect of just playing galaxy where the long jump is a huge part of movement but i feel it should be stronger in 3d land. also the l and r buttons on the 3ds feel horrible and too clicky and uncomfortable to press.Overall:7.9/10 there are ups and downs to this game but it's still good at the end of the day.

Super Mario 3D Land was always a childhood favorite of mine, and having the pleasure of playing through this game as an adult to acquire a full sense of what makes this game everything it is, is very satisfying. When the Wii came out and Mario Galaxy was the newest Mario 3D platformer title, it was amazing, as we all know. As a child at the time though, I didn't have a Wii of my own. My time on Mario Galaxy was limited. So when they released a much similar game on the 3DS 4 years later, a console that I could call my own, it felt magical. I could play it whenever I wanted, wherever I wanted. Let's admit though, If you took Mario Galaxy and removed the outer-space aesthetic, Mario 3D Land would pretty much be a compact 3DS version of Mario Galaxy. From level style to textures to sound design. I played this game entirely in 3D. Whilst I'm 100% completing my library, I'd quite like to get the full intended experience while I'm at it. However, even with 3D mode enabled, I was still occasionally having trouble comprehending depth perception through motions that moved toward or away from the given perspective. I would get it eventually but only through muscle memory and a few attempts at the troubling section. Not sure if this is a game thing, a console thing, or a me thing. A key thing I noticed quite far into the Luigi levels was that the themes and patterns were all very similar to each other and a little repetitive. Now, I know reusing textures and enemies is probably a key sacrifice in creating such an experience on a small handheld such as the (near) 14 year old 3DS, but it definitely didn't go unnoticed. Unfortunately, the game was much easier than I remember it being. I sort of found myself rushing through the levels as I knew there wasn't going to be any real challenge or any preparation required at any point. That was until I started the Luigi levels. Throughout the whole underground experience, the levels were of a difficulty that kept me interested from start to finish. It's rare that a game re-peaks my interest so late into a playthrough but honestly, the fun started all over again. I completed this game in December 2024, not far from 14 years after this game came out. I can say with the utmost confidence that this game is, and will forever be, utterly timeless. The game does not feel 14 years old in the slightest. I mean, it's 3D for Pete's sake. Whilst admittedly a gimmick, it really puts you in the game and is still amazing to this day. Let's not gloss over the soundtrack either. Is there yet to be a Mario game without a soundtrack that makes a player bop? I think not. Super Mario 3D Land is no exception. My favorite tracks are the ones that play in the desert type areas. All in all, the overall experience was not quite as enjoyable as I remember it being, but that doesn't take away from what the game is. It has variety in terms of challenges and difficulty, despite its lack of variety in enemies, textures, and themes. It's simple, but later proves challenging for more experienced players who are willing to get that far. It's generally charming to say the least. I'd recommend to anybody with a 3DS just to experience what a 3D Mario game looks and feels like when in true 3D. (Completed with 5 shiny star profile).

Super Mario 3D Land is a great 3D Mario game, even though it’s more classic and generic than other titles in the series. The game has a great soundtrack that fits each level perfectly. Most levels feature a unique gimmick or are simply very well designed for platforming. Combined with well implemented power-ups, Super Mario 3D Land offers a strong foundation of simple, fun and engaging gameplay. The S-Worlds, which include harder variants and sometimes completely new levels, increase the overall experience and even provide a good amount of challenge. While the game might lack a big, defining gameplay gimmick like other 3D Mario games and feels a bit more traditional and generic, its polished gameplay and perfectly tuned design for the 3DS make it easily able to compete with other great titles in the series. The only real downside is that the controls feel a bit janky. But in the end, this game remains fantastic and is definitely worth playing. 9,3/10
